Responsibilities:

JOB DUTIES:

  • Under general supervision, responsible for professionally installing cable in field site hole and spool the cable as it is pulled from the hole.
  • Load, perform pre-trip inspection, transport cable spool from the shop to the field site location and rig up.
  • Band cable to the tubing as the cable is run into the hole, splice or pack off cable and handle pulls of cable to the spool.
  • Responsible for unloading cable at the shop and reloading for next trip.
  • Prepare paperwork to include DOT requirements, IFTA reports, billable and non-billable hours and mileage.
  • Job tasks, correctly performed, impact indirectly on cost containment, efficiency, profitability or operations.
  • Maintain mechanical performance of truck used in transportation to and from the field.
  • Train and mentor lower-level technicians at the well site.
  • Trains and coach’s new hires in basic principles.
